Best Plants to Keep Mosquitos Away

Backyards are meant for you to enjoy and have fun with your family and friends and not meant to be bothered by unwanted visitors like mosquitoes. There are many ways of getting rid of these pests besides using a zapper or candles that give off an odour. The natural way would be to surround yourself with these plants that will help. The plants by themselves will not produce the scent required to keep them away but will have to be secreted by rubbing them between your fingers. What is more effective is using the natural oils that is obtained from these plants.

  •  Eucalyptus They are generally tall trees or shrubs which grows well in sunlight. They are usually drought resistant, and they grow well in environments that offer a hot climate. It is known as a therapeutic plant because the oily leaves secrete a menthol scent when rubbed together which acts as a deterrent for bugs and mosquitoes.
  • Neem is a medical plant used by many farmers who which to focus on organic farming techniques to produce healthier food consumption for humans and also which helps the environment. It is also used to treat plant with fungicides. Neem requires a hot climate. The plant is found in many Caribbean, South America and many other countries.
  • Rosemary Is an amazing plant used in many culinary dishes. It also has been used in the treatment of hair. Besides all of this this it is also a deterrent against mosquitoes.
  • Garlic Its pungent smell keeps those bugs away.
  • Peppermint besides its wonderful properties for teas. Mosquitoes are not attracted to the smell.
